House Beam Replacement in Kansas City, KS

House beam replacement services involve removing and installing new support beams within a property’s structure to ensure stability and safety. This service typically covers projects such as replacing sagging or damaged beams in basements, crawl spaces, or load-bearing walls, as well as upgrading old or compromised supports during renovations or foundation repairs. Property owners often seek this service when noticing signs of structural issues, including uneven flooring, cracks in walls, or bowing ceilings, and want to understand the scope of work, materials used, and potential impact on their property before proceeding.

Project Types

Common House Beam Replacement Jobs

House beam replacement involves removing and installing new support beams to ensure structural stability.

Load-bearing beam replacement addresses compromised beams that support the weight of the home’s structure.

Floor joist replacement restores the foundation of floors affected by damaged or rotting beams.

Basement beam replacement reinforces or replaces beams supporting basement foundations.

Roof support beam replacement ensures the integrity of roof framing and prevents sagging or collapse.

Post and beam replacement repairs or replaces vertical supports to maintain overall building safety.

FAQ

House Beam Replacement Questions

What are signs that a house beam needs replacement? Signs include sagging floors, cracks in walls or ceilings, and unusual creaking sounds in the structure.

How does beam replacement improve a property's safety? Replacing damaged beams restores structural integrity, helping to prevent potential collapses or further damage.

What types of beams are commonly replaced in homes? Commonly replaced beams include load-bearing wooden beams, steel beams, and engineered wood products.

Is beam replacement suitable for both new and older homes? Yes, beam replacement can be performed on both new constructions and older properties requiring structural repairs.
